    It doesn't. Ever. They're generally not good games, they're not the best JRPGs in their respective fields unless you really like a certain style.

    I - III are really their own deal
    IV & V their own small set too with a larger focus on narrative and battle
    VI is the middle ground between V & VII and is the best game in the series for people who hate VII and for some reason never played IX or XII
    VII is VI again but in a modern setting with more gameplay stripped out
    VIII is the same shit again but now we're doing gimmicks
    IX is a director returning to try and make a classic FF and is for some the best FF like VI or overrated
    X is just VII & VIII again but no sci-fi
    X-2 is the perverted fantasy of a man who loves transformation scenes
    XI is an MMO made by a team who didn't play MMO's
    XII is an SRPG with an MMO style battle system (kinda but not kinda), planning and an amazing story/setting/follow up to FF tactics by a man who makes SRPGs who had a meltdown, quit the industry and had the director of V, VI & IX take his place to finish the game
    XIII is the perverted fantasy of a man who loves transformation scenes when he's told to make FF VII again but not FF VII
    XIII-2 is the perverted fantasy of a man who loves transformation scenes who said "I'll do it right this time, for my waifu lightning, this will redeem her character" then he kind of forgot to have her in the game
    LIGHTNING RETURNS: FINAL FANTASY XIII is the perverted fantasy of a man who loves transformation scenes who said "i'll do it right this time, for my waifu lighting, this will redeem her character, for reals this time" but he made a dress up simulator based on a nonsensical plot in the future barely connected to the other 2 games
    XIV 1.0 was an MMO made by a team who didn't play MMO's but made an MMO before
    XV was the other star studded XIII game that was in development hell for so long that it changed hands and XIII's sequels got greenlit.

    And that's FF. They all fricking suck.
